Urban horticulture holds tremendous value for several reasons. It brings forth environmental advantages such as enhanced air top quality, minimized city warmth island impact, and stormwater overflow mitigation. It adds to food protection and self-sufficiency by advertising neighborhood food production and making sure access to nutritious fruit and vegetables. Urban horticulture cultivates community engagement and social communication, creating common eco-friendly rooms and instilling a sense of belonging and pride amongst locals.

Room identifies the kind of city farm you'll run, so do your research to identify what is and isn't allowed in your wanted space. Whether you're considering starting a metropolitan garden in your home or for the community, analyze what kind would serve you finest. Assess the type of garden that would deal with the details issues of your house or area.


If you have access to outdoor room, remember of the sunlight, square video, and accessibility to water. In tight city settings, observe and note any kind of trees, buildings, or various other blockages that might cast shadows on your yard throughout the growing period. Avoid growing veggies or flowering plants that require bright light in low-light areas and vice versa.


Use high quality soil and suitable containers to guarantee healthy plant development. Water your garden routinely and ensure correct drain to avoid waterlogging. Exercise buddy growing and crop rotation to optimise plant health and wellness and minimise insects. Dedicate time to normal upkeep and implement pest control approaches as required. Select your gardening method based upon the outcomes you receive from examining your area and demands.

Herbs and salad eco-friendlies are prominent due to their portable dimension and quick growth. Tomatoes and peppers grow in urban gardens and offer plentiful harvests. Root veggies, such as carrots and radishes, can be grown in containers or elevated beds. Climbing plants like beans and cucumbers can be trained on trellises to optimize upright area.


Urban gardens usually profit from warmer microclimates, permitting the growing of less durable plants such as palms and bamboo commonly located in warmer regions. And as we have actually stated, do not just opt for tiny plants; small city gardens can handle big plants and trees and picking these over tiny picky hedges will make the area feel larger and a lot more amazing.


Utilize huge containers they don't dry as swiftly as smaller sized pots, so they are much less work to keep water.
